Unlocking the Perfect Kitchen: 6 Ideal cabinet Layouts

Revamping your kitchen or planning a new one? Ensuring a practical kitchen layout is a top-notch priority. Our guide covers key dimensions and workflow arrangements to optimize your kitchen space.
1. U-Shaped LayoutPros: - Plenty of counter and cabinet space.- Offers separation for the kitchen.Cons:- Limited space for work aisles.- Challenges with corner cabinets. 2. G-Shaped LayoutPros:- Ample counter space with a multi-use peninsula.- Multiple options for work triangles.Cons:- Complex layout.- Restricted traffic flow. 3. L-Shaped LayoutPros: - Optimal workspace with an open concept.- Can increase home value.Cons:- Frustrating for single cooks.- More workspace to clean. 4. Galley LayoutPros:- Maximum function and efficiency.- Suitable for small spaces.Cons:- Tends to be narrow.- Limited storage. 5. One-Wall LayoutPros:- Space-efficient and cost-effective.- Ideal for one or two people.Cons:- May feel cramped.- Not suitable for large families. 6. Island LayoutPros:- Extra storage and work surfaces.- Added seating.Cons:- Not ideal for small kitchens.- Expensive. Other Considerations:Work Triangles- Efficiently position sink, refrigerator, and stovetop.- Keep each leg of the triangle between 4 and 9 feet. Work Aisles and Walkways- Work aisles (cooking and cleaning) need a minimum clearance of 42 inches.- Walkways require a minimum clearance of 36 inches. Countertop Dimensions- Standard width: 25.5-28 inches with a 1.5-inch overhang.- Standard height: 36 inches (approximately 3 inches below elbow height). Landing Areas- Designate open spaces on countertops for food prep, next to the cooktop, and next to the sink.- Create a kitchen that's not just visually appealing but also a functional hub for your home. - Consider these layouts and essential factors for a cooking space that perfectly suits your needs.
